Key Facts

  • Your marginal rate is 37.00% — the next dollar earned is taxed at 37.00%.
  • The standard deduction of $15,000 reduces your taxable income from $46,810,000 to $46,795,000.
  • After federal income tax, Social Security ($10,918), and Medicare ($1,098,235), take-home is $28,429,677 — 60.73% of gross pay.
  • Married filing jointly at $46,810,000 pays only $17,232,663 in federal tax due to the $30,000 standard deduction.
